ACESS数据库表备份全攻略
acess数据库怎么备份表

首页 2025-04-05 13:10:38



Access数据库表备份的全面指南 在当今信息化时代,数据的安全性和完整性是企业或个人用户不可忽视的重要问题

    Access数据库作为Microsoft Office套件中的一部分,广泛应用于各类数据管理场景

    然而,数据意外丢失或损坏的风险始终存在,因此,定期备份Access数据库表成为了确保数据安全的关键步骤

    本文将详细介绍Access数据库表的备份方法,帮助用户高效、安全地完成这一重要任务

     一、Access数据库备份的重要性 Access数据库备份是数据管理的基础,它的重要性体现在以下几个方面: 1.数据恢复:在遭遇硬件故障、软件错误或人为误操作导致数据丢失时,备份文件是恢复数据的唯一途径

     2.数据安全:通过定期备份,可以确保数据在遭受恶意攻击或病毒感染时得到保护

     3.业务连续性:对于关键业务数据,如财务数据、客户信息等,备份是保证业务连续性的重要手段

     二、Access数据库表备份的基本方法 Access数据库表的备份方法多种多样,用户可以根据实际需求选择最适合自己的方式

    以下是几种常见的备份方法: 1. 使用内置工具备份 Access提供了内置的备份工具,用户可以通过简单的操作即可完成备份

    具体步骤如下: - 打开Access数据库,在“文件”菜单中选择“备份数据库”

     - 在弹出的对话框中,选择保存位置和文件名

    建议选择一个易于记忆且安全的目录,如专门的数据库备份文件夹,并在文件名中包含备份日期等有意义的信息,如“数据库名称_备份日期.accdb”

     - 点击“保存”按钮,Access将开始备份数据库表,并在指定位置生成备份文件

     这种方法简单直接,适用于不频繁的数据变更或需要即时备份的情况

     2. 使用“另存为”功能备份 除了内置的备份工具外,用户还可以通过“另存为”功能备份Access数据库表

    具体步骤如下: - 打开Access数据库,在“文件”菜单中选择“另存为”

     - 在弹出的对话框中,选择保存位置和文件名,并确认保存类型为“Access数据库(.accdb)”或“Access 2000/2002/2003数据库(.mdb)”,这取决于原数据库的格式

     - 点击“保存”按钮,Access将在指定位置生成备份文件

     这种方法同样简单快捷,适用于需要快速备份整个数据库的情况

     3. 使用VBA脚本备份 对于需要更灵活备份策略的用户,可以使用VBA脚本实现自动化备份

    通过编写VBA脚本,用户可以定义复杂的备份逻辑,如差异备份或增量备份,从而只备份自上次备份以来发生变化的数据

    此外,用户还可以将备份任务安排在特定时间自动执行,减少人为干预

     使用VBA脚本备份的具体步骤如下: - 打开Access数据库,在“开发者”选项卡中选择“宏”组,然后点击“宏”按钮

     - 在宏编辑器中编写备份数据库的VBA脚本

    脚本中应包含打开数据库、复制数据库文件到备份位置、关闭数据库等操作

     - 保存并运行宏,Access将按照脚本定义的逻辑执行备份任务

     需要注意的是,使用VBA脚本备份需要一定的编程知识,且脚本的编写和维护成本相对较高

     4. 使用命令行备份 对于熟悉命令行操作的用户,可以使用copy命令来备份Access数据库表

    具体步骤如下: - 打开命令提示符窗口(在Windows系统中,按下“Win + R”键,输入“cmd”并回车)

     - 使用copy命令复制数据库文件到备份位置

    例如,假设数据库文件位于“C:UsersYourNameDocumentsAccessDatabaseName.accdb”,要备份到“D:Backups”文件夹,可以在命令提示符中输入以下命令:`copy C:UsersYourNameDocumentsAccessDatabaseName.accdb D:BackupsDatabaseName_BackupDate.accdb`

    其中,“DatabaseName_BackupDate.accdb”是备份文件的名称,可根据需要修改

     - 执行命令后,系统会开始复制文件,完成备份

     这种方法适用于需要自动化备份或在不方便使用图形界面的情况下进行备份的情况

    然而,它同样需要用户具备一定的命令行操作知识

     5. 使用第三方备份软件 除了上述方法外,用户还可以选择使用第三方备份软件来备份Access数据库表

    第三方备份软件通常提供更丰富的功能,如自动化备份、远程备份、数据加密和压缩等

    在选择第三方备份软件时,用户应考虑其与Access数据库的兼容性、备份效率以及成本效益

     使用第三方备份软件备份的具体步骤因软件而异,但通常包括以下几个步骤: - 下载并安装第三方备份软件

     - 在软件中配置备份任务,包括选择备份的Access数据库表、设置备份位置和时间等

     - 启动备份任务,软件将按照配置自动执行备份操作

     三、Access数据库表备份的注意事项 在备份Access数据库表时,用户还应注意以下几个方面: 1.备份频率:根据业务需求和数据变更频率确定备份频率

    对于关键业务数据,建议每天进行备份;对于不太敏感的数据,可以每周或每月备份一次

    在进行重大数据修改或系统更新之前,也应及时备份数据库

     2.存储位置:选择一个安全的备份存储位置,最好是物理上与原数据库文件不同的地方,以防止单点故障

    同时,确保备份文件也受到适当的保护,如设置访问权限或使用加密技术

     3.文件命名规范:采用易于识别和管理的文件命名规范,如添加日期时间信息到备份文件名中

    这有助于后续的管理和恢复过程

     4.测试恢复过程:定期测试恢复过程,确保在需要时能够顺利恢复数据

    这可以通过将备份文件导入到另一个Access数据库中进行验证来实现

     5.备份完整性检查:在备份完成后,应对备份文件进行完整性检查,确保备份的数据与原始数据一致

    这可以通过比较文件大小、校验和等方式来实现

     四、结语 Access数据库表的备份是确保数据安全性和完整性的重要步骤

    通过选择合适的备份方法并遵循注意事项,用户可以高效地完成备份任务并保护自己的数据免受意外损失

    无论是个人用户还是企业用户,都应重视数据库的备份工作并定期进行备份

    在遇到意外情况时,备份文件将成为恢复数据的唯一途径,从而最大程度地减少数据损失并保障业务的连续性

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道